2004 Alfa Romeo GTV | 1962 Nissan Bluebird | |
Make | Alfa Romeo | Nissan |
Model | GTV | Bluebird |
Year Released | 2004 | 1962 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1970 cc | 1189 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 2 valves |
Horse Power | 163 HP | 53 HP |
Engine RPM | 6200 RPM | 4800 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line - Premium | Gasoline |
Vehicle Weight | 1440 kg | 900 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4310 mm | 3920 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1780 mm | 1500 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1320 mm | 1480 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2600 mm | 2290 mm |
